Genz-10850 is a synthetic small molecule compound characterized by a complex molecular structure that includes a piperazine ring, fluorene moiety, and indole ring[2][3]. It belongs to the class of organic compounds known as fluorenes[1]. Genz-10850 acts as an inhibitor of enoyl-[acyl-carrier-protein] reductase (NADH), which is part of the mycobacterial type II fatty acid synthase (FAS-II) system. This enzyme is essential for the synthesis of mycolic acids in Mycobacterium tuberculosis, making it a potential target for antitubercular drug development[4][6]. The compound has been investigated primarily in preclinical studies for its antimycobacterial activity.
